The City of Danbury is now hiring a Seasonal Parks Maintainer for the Summer 2026 season. The City of Danbury is seeking Seasonal Park Maintainers to support the upkeep, repair, and general maintenance of City parks, recreational facilities, and grounds. This position performs a variety of semi-skilled manual labor tasks related to landscaping, groundskeeping, and minor facility maintenance to ensure safe, clean, and well-maintained public spaces. Work is performed under the supervision of a higher-level employee, with many tasks becoming routine after initial training. This position requires the ability to work outdoors in varying weather conditions and to perform physically demanding tasks on a consistent basis. Essential Duties and Responsibilities Maintain park grounds, including lawns, athletic fields, gardens, playgrounds, and recreational areas Perform landscaping tasks such as mowing, trimming, raking, planting, watering, and pruning trees and shrubs Groom and line athletic fields, including baseball and soccer fields, on a routine basis Clean and maintain park facilities, including benches, fencing, and public-use areas Paint and repair park structures such as benches, tables, fences, and buildings Operate and maintain light and medium-duty equipment, including mowers, tractors, blowers, rakes, rollers, and small trucks Assist with seasonal operations such as leaf removal, snow removal, and ice control Perform minor maintenance and basic repairs to tools and equipment Load, unload, and transport materials, supplies, and equipment as needed Support setup and breakdown of park events or recreational activities when required Follow all safety procedures and report hazards, damages, or unsafe conditions Perform related duties as assigned Minimum Qualifications Must be at least 18 years of age Ability to perform manual labor and work outdoors in varying weather conditions Basic knowledge of groundskeeping tools, equipment, and safety practices preferred Ability to operate or learn to operate light equipment and vehicles Ability to obtain a Connecticut Commercial Driver's License (CDL) is preferred but not required for all assignments Knowledge, Skills, and Abilities Ability to follow instructions and work independently or as part of a team Strong work ethic and reliability Basic mechanical aptitude for equipment use and maintenance Awareness of workplace safety practices Ability to complete repetitive tasks efficiently and accurately Physical Demands The physical demands described here are representative of those that must be met to successfully perform the essential functions of this position, with or without reasonable accommodation: Frequent standing, walking, bending, stooping, kneeling, and reaching Frequent lifting, carrying, pushing, and pulling of materials up to 50 pounds; occasional lifting up to 100 pounds with assistance Ability to operate equipment and tools requiring manual dexterity Ability to work for extended periods outdoors in heat, cold, humidity, or inclement weather Work Environment Work is performed primarily outdoors in park and recreational settings Exposure to weather conditions, noise from equipment, and environmental elements such as dust, grass, and debris May involve working near active recreational areas and interacting with the public
